La voz de los silenciados2014
Bricolagista's debut feature film, LA VOZ DE LOS SILENCIADOS takes us inside the mind and heartbreak of Olga, a deaf teenager brought from Latin America to New York City, under the false promise of attending a "Christian Sign Language School." Upon arrival she enters a world of human trafficking, and life is turned upside-down as Olga is enslaved by an international criminal ring. Forced to beg on the subway, she uses courage, cunning and even humor to face an unimaginable nightmare-on-loop that ravages the audience. The film is based on a true story.
